Pros & Cons
Microsoft Surface Pro 9
Pros
- Full Windows 11 experience in a tablet form factor
- 120Hz PixelSense Flow display is sharp and smooth
- Thunderbolt 4 on Intel models for pro connectivity
- Removable SSD for easy storage upgrades and data security
- Versatile kickstand adapts to any angle for laptop or studio mode
Cons
- Type Cover keyboard and Slim Pen sold separately — adds $300+
- Fanless design throttles under sustained heavy workloads
- SQ3 (ARM) model has app compatibility issues
- Base $999 only gets i5/8 GB/128 GB — underpowered for the price
OnePlus Pad Pro
Pros
- Snapdragon 8 Gen 3 makes this one of the most powerful Android tablets
- 144Hz display is buttery smooth for scrolling and gaming
- 3K resolution with 12.1-inch screen is stunning for media
- Wi-Fi 7 connectivity is future-proof
- OnePlus Stylo pen support for note-taking
Cons
- LCD panel — no OLED vibrancy at this price tier
- No cellular connectivity option
- Android tablet app optimization is still behind iPadOS
- Accessories (keyboard, stylus) sold separately
Full Specifications
| Spec | Microsoft Surface Pro 9 | OnePlus Pad Pro |
|---|---|---|
| Software | Windows 11 Home / Pro | Android 14 (OxygenOS) |
| Body | ||
| Weight | 879 g | 584 g |
| Dimensions | 287 x 209 x 9.3 mm | 268.7 x 195.1 x 6.5 mm |
| Memory | ||
| RAM | 8 GB / 16 GB / 32 GB | — |
| Storage options | 128 GB, 256 GB, 512 GB, 1 TB | — |
| Battery | ||
| Battery life | Up to 15.5 hours (typical usage) | Up to 12 hours video playback |
| Capacity | 47.7 Wh | 9510 mAh |
| Display | ||
| Size | 13 inches | 12.1 inches |
| Type | PixelSense Flow IPS | IPS LCD |
| Resolution | 2880 x 1920 | 3000 x 2120 |
| Refresh rate | 120Hz | 144Hz |
| Features | Surface Slim Pen 2 support with haptic feedback, Removable SSD, Built-in kickstand, Windows Hello face authentication | — |
| Processor | ||
| CPU | 10-core (2P + 8E) on Intel models | — |
| GPU | Intel Iris Xe / Adreno 8cx Gen 3 | — |
| Chipset | Intel Core i5-1235U / i7-1255U (or Microsoft SQ3 for 5G model) | Qualcomm Snapdragon 8 Gen 3 |
| RAM | — | 12 GB |
| Connectivity | ||
| USB | 2x USB-C (Thunderbolt 4 on Intel) | USB-C 3.2 |
| Wi-Fi | Wi-Fi 6E | Wi-Fi 7 |
| Cellular | Optional 5G (SQ3 model) | |
| Bluetooth | 5.1 | — |
